博客 矿产轻量化数据中台架构与实时流处理实现

矿产轻量化数据中台架构与实时流处理实现

   数栈君   发表于 2026-03-27 19:10  33  0

矿产轻量化数据中台架构与实时流处理实现 🏔️📊

在矿业数字化转型的浪潮中,传统数据系统因结构臃肿、响应迟缓、集成困难,已难以支撑现代矿山对实时监控、智能预警与决策优化的迫切需求。为破解这一瓶颈,矿产轻量化数据中台应运而生。它不是对原有系统的简单升级,而是一套以“轻、快、准、通”为核心理念的新型数据基础设施,专为矿产行业高并发、多源异构、环境严苛的场景设计。


什么是矿产轻量化数据中台?

矿产轻量化数据中台是一种面向矿山生产全链条的轻量级数据聚合、治理与服务引擎。它通过模块化架构、边缘预处理、流批一体计算和低代码服务封装,实现从传感器、PLC、视频监控、地质勘探设备等异构数据源中,高效抽取、清洗、标准化并实时分发数据,支撑上层应用如数字孪生、能耗优化、设备预测性维护、安全预警等。

与传统数据中台相比,它有三大核心差异:

  • :不依赖重型数据库与复杂ETL流程,采用内存计算与流式处理引擎,部署包体积可控制在500MB以内,适合边缘节点部署。
  • :端到端延迟低于500ms,支持每秒万级点位的实时写入与查询。
  • :内置矿山行业标准协议适配器(如Modbus、OPC UA、MQTT、IEC 61850),无需定制开发即可接入主流矿用设备。

这种架构特别适用于中小型矿山、露天矿段、尾矿库、选矿厂等资源有限但数字化需求迫切的场景。


架构设计:五层轻量化模型 🏗️

一个成熟的矿产轻量化数据中台,通常由以下五层构成,每一层均经过行业场景优化:

1. 边缘接入层:数据入口的“神经末梢” 📡

在矿山现场,传感器、振动监测仪、粉尘浓度计、GPS定位终端等设备数据格式多样、通信协议不一。边缘接入层通过轻量级网关(如基于Rust或Go开发的边缘代理)实现:

  • 协议自动识别与转换(无需人工配置)
  • 数据压缩(采用Snappy或Zstandard,降低带宽占用40%以上)
  • 断点续传与本地缓存(网络中断时可缓存72小时数据)

举例:某铁矿在皮带运输机部署了200个振动传感器,每秒产生1.2万条数据。通过边缘网关过滤无效值、合并冗余采样,仅传输有效特征数据,带宽消耗从12Mbps降至1.8Mbps。

2. 流式处理层:实时计算的“心脏” ❤️

传统批处理延迟高达小时级,无法满足安全预警需求。本层采用Apache Flink或Kafka Streams构建流处理引擎,实现:

  • 实时异常检测(如设备温度突升、矿车超速)
  • 滑动窗口聚合(每5秒计算一次皮带负载均值)
  • 多流关联(将地质钻探数据与开采进度数据动态关联)

处理逻辑采用“规则引擎+机器学习模型”双驱动模式。例如,当某区域CO浓度连续3次超过阈值,系统自动触发通风系统联动,同时推送告警至移动端。

3. 轻量存储层:结构化与非结构化并存 🗃️

为降低资源占用,存储层采用分层策略:

  • 时序数据库(如TDengine、InfluxDB):存储传感器时序数据,支持每秒百万级写入,压缩率高达90%
  • 对象存储(MinIO):存放视频片段、地质扫描图、巡检照片
  • 内存缓存(Redis):保存实时状态快照,供前端可视化快速调用

所有数据均按“矿井-区域-设备”三级标签体系组织,支持按空间维度快速检索。

4. 服务封装层:API即服务 🔄

该层将复杂的数据处理能力封装为标准化RESTful API与WebSocket接口,供上层应用调用,无需理解底层逻辑。典型服务包括:

  • /api/v1/realtime/temperature?mine_id=001 → 返回实时温度曲线
  • /api/v1/alerts/active → 获取当前未处理告警列表
  • /api/v1/forecast/equipment?device_id=DEV-205 → 返回未来24小时故障概率

所有接口支持JWT鉴权、QPS限流、响应缓存,确保系统安全与稳定。

5. 可视化与应用层:决策的“仪表盘” 🖥️

此层不依赖大型BI工具,而是采用轻量前端框架(如Vue3 + ECharts)构建动态看板,支持:

  • 实时地图热力图(显示井下人员分布)
  • 设备健康度仪表盘(基于剩余寿命预测)
  • 历史趋势对比(对比本周与上周能耗变化)

所有图表可拖拽布局,支持手机端扫码访问,无需安装客户端。


实时流处理的关键技术实现 🔧

实时流处理是矿产轻量化数据中台的核心能力。其关键技术点包括:

✅ 事件驱动架构(EDA)

所有数据变更均以事件形式发布(如“设备停机”、“瓦斯超标”),由事件总线(Kafka)分发至多个消费者:告警模块、报表模块、工单系统。实现“一次产生,多方消费”。

✅ 状态管理与容错机制

使用Chandy-Lamport快照算法,保障流处理过程中的状态一致性。即使节点宕机,也可在3秒内恢复,数据不丢失。

✅ 动态规则引擎

支持用户通过Web界面配置“IF-THEN”规则,例如:

IF 温度 > 85℃ AND 持续时间 > 10sTHEN 发送短信至矿长 + 启动喷淋系统 + 记录事件日志

规则可热更新,无需重启服务,极大提升运维灵活性。

✅ 边云协同计算

将简单计算(如阈值判断)下沉至边缘,复杂分析(如AI模型推理)上传至云端。实现“边缘做判断,云端做优化”,降低带宽压力,提升响应速度。


应用场景:从理论到落地 🚀

场景一:尾矿库安全监测

在尾矿坝体部署150个位移传感器与雨量计,中台实时计算坝体变形速率。当变形速率超过0.5mm/h,自动触发三级预警,并联动无人机巡检任务。系统上线后,预警响应时间从4小时缩短至8秒。

场景二:选矿能耗优化

采集破碎机、球磨机、浮选机的电流、功率、给矿量数据,通过流处理计算单位矿石能耗。系统自动推荐最优给矿频率,使单位电耗降低12.7%,年节省电费超280万元。

场景三:人员定位与应急疏散

井下人员佩戴UWB定位标签,中台实时计算人员分布密度与移动轨迹。在突发冒顶事件中,系统自动生成最优疏散路径,并通过防爆终端推送至每位员工。


部署与运维:低成本、高可用 💡

矿产轻量化数据中台支持容器化部署(Docker + Kubernetes),可在:

  • 工业级边缘服务器(如华为Atlas 500)
  • 云服务器(阿里云ECS、腾讯云CVM)
  • 私有化部署环境

支持一键部署、自动扩缩容、远程日志采集。运维人员无需精通大数据技术,仅需掌握基础Web界面操作即可完成系统监控与配置。

某铜矿在3天内完成中台部署,投入人力仅2人,月运维成本低于传统方案的1/5。


为什么选择轻量化?——对比传统方案

维度传统数据中台矿产轻量化数据中台
部署周期3–6个月3–7天
硬件要求高配服务器+专用存储工业级边缘设备即可
学习成本需大数据团队普通IT人员3天上手
响应延迟小时级秒级
扩展性依赖厂商定制插件式模块,自主扩展
成本50万+8万–15万

轻量化不是妥协,而是精准适配。在资源有限、环境复杂、响应要求高的矿山场景中,效率远比规模重要。


未来趋势:与数字孪生深度融合 🤖

矿产轻量化数据中台是构建矿山数字孪生体的“数据底座”。它提供的实时、准确、结构化的数据流,可驱动三维可视化模型动态更新,实现:

  • 设备运行状态与虚拟模型同步
  • 采掘进度与地质模型叠加分析
  • 模拟不同开采方案下的安全风险

未来,中台将接入更多AI模型,实现“感知→分析→决策→执行”闭环,推动矿山从“自动化”迈向“自主化”。


如何启动你的矿产轻量化数据中台项目?

  1. 评估数据源:列出所有在用传感器与系统,确认协议类型
  2. 选定试点区域:选择1–2个关键产线或区域(如主通风系统)
  3. 部署轻量网关:安装边缘代理,采集3天原始数据
  4. 配置规则引擎:设定3条核心告警规则
  5. 上线可视化看板:展示关键指标,获取一线反馈

整个过程可在两周内完成,ROI(投资回报率)通常在6个月内实现。

申请试用&https://www.dtstack.com/?src=bbs申请试用&https://www.dtstack.com/?src=bbs申请试用&https://www.dtstack.com/?src=bbs


结语:轻,是数字矿山的终极答案

在矿业数字化的道路上,不是所有企业都需要“大而全”的系统。矿产轻量化数据中台以极简架构、极低门槛、极高效率,为中小矿山打开了通往智能矿山的大门。它不追求技术炫技,只解决真实问题——让每一份数据,都成为安全与效率的基石。

当数据不再沉默,矿山便有了智慧。当系统足够轻盈,变革才能真正落地。

立即行动,开启你的矿山数字化第一步:申请试用&https://www.dtstack.com/?src=bbs

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料